COMMERCIAL DESCRIPTION
Abita Turbodog is a dark brown ale brewed with Willamette hops and a combination of British pale, crystal and chocolate malts. This combination gives Turbodog its rich body and color and a sweet chocolate-toffee like flavor.

CanIHave4Beers (2000) - Des Moines, Iowa, USA - FEB 1, 2012
Pours a deep reddish brown color with a medium sized head and good lacing on the glass.

The aroma is nutty and lightly roasty with some vanilla and a kind of odd dirty malt character.

The flavor is roasty and sort of green tasting with a mild bitterness and some light fruity flavors. The beer gets nuttier as it warms.
